As summer sets in, wildfires once again scorch Himachal forests; Mandi, Bilaspur worst hit

Summary by thenewzradar.com
With temperatures climbing across Himachal Pradesh, forest fires have made a fierce comeback. In the first nine days of April alone, 15 incidents were reported across seven forest circles, destroying nearly 114 hectares of green cover. Mandi was the worst affected, losing 54 hectares, followed by Bilaspur with 30 hectares.
